Training Overview:

In this 2 day upgrade course we cover everything the student needs to know to upgrade from VMware vSphere 4.x to VMware’s new vSphere 5.0 product. Students will perform the actual upgrade using hands-on-labs in our state of the art data center, then once that objective is achieved they will be exposed to all the new features of the product, to include third party solutions and lessons learn in the field.

The key difference between this class and VMware’s What’s New class is that in this class the student will actually perform a real upgrade to start off the class. The servers are preloaded with VMware ESXi 4.1 Update 1 and vCenter 4.1 Update 1. The students will look at the different options to perform the upgrade to vSphere 5.0 and then actually upgrade both vCenter and ESXi. After this, they will then cover all of the new features included with vSphere 5.

Prerequisites: 

Students should have 1-3 year experience as a VMware administrator using VMware vSphere 4.x, be familiar with virtual technologies and have sat a VMware Authorized training program, Ultimate Bootcamp or equivalent within the last year. Students MUST know the vSphere 4.x product line or they will need to have taken one of the other full vSphere 4.x classes instead.
